The popular map as seen in the RTS Supreme Commander.

NOTE: It may dump the file into the mods folder instead of the maps folder. To fix this, take the map file from the mods folder and throw it into the maps folder.

The path varies. I found mine under My Games/Sid Meier's Civilization 5/Mods

There you will find the Maps and MODS folders.
